DISCUSSION:

Each year, the California Department of Education requests that agencies funded through their Department certify their intention to continue receiving funding the following fiscal year. The City Council's consideration and approval of the Continued Funding Application (CFA) for Fiscal Year 2026-2027 will ensure continued program services to the residents and children of La Habra. The CFA for preschool services proposes to serve approximately 165 children between the ages of two and a half and five years old at three childcare facilities in La Habra.

The California State Preschool Program (CSPP) funding will be used by the City's Child Development Division to:
  • Offer quality, comprehensive education and development programs for children with an emphasis on preparing each child for Kindergarten.
  • Provide a wide variety of educational activities to enhance and expand the school experience through support and involvement with community partners.
  • Provide a healthy and nutritious dietary supplement for the children participating in the program.
  • Provide quality parent involvement and an educational component to enhance the family unit through educational and engaging activities.
  • Assess each child in all areas of development and design a curriculum planned to meet the individual needs of each child.
  • Provide a safe, comforting environment where each child feels free to grow at their own developmental pace.
The Child Development Division offers services for up to 165 children through the California State Preschool Program (CSPP) contract, providing either Full-Day or Part-Day preschool services.  Enrolled children receive child care and educational enrichment programs for up to three years before entering kindergarten. To satisfy the mandates of the CSPP contract, services must be provided for at least 175 days for the part-day program and 246 days for the full-day program. This program also provides services for children eligible for Transitional Kindergarten and addresses the needs of working parents in the La Habra community. Childcare and educational services are provided for three hours for Part-Day Preschool and up to 11.5 hours for Full-Day service.

The grant contract is estimated at $2,487,180, which is based on the amount received by the City for the current Fiscal Year 2025 -26 contract.

FISCAL IMPACT/SOURCE OF FUNDING:

All Child Development Division funding is provided through State and Federal grants. The California State Preschool Program is entirely funded by the State Department of Education for a total of approximately $2,487,180, based on current funding levels. All program administration costs, up to a maximum of 15% of the total grant award, are reimbursed through the contract and the program does not receive any General Fund support.
